#source: http://www.binrand.com/post/469178-crc-use-strict-use-warnings-use-string-crc32-use-xchat-qw.html (13-Oct-2012)
# I don't know who posted this there, but all I did was change the file open syntax (protospork)
use strict;
use warnings;
use String::CRC32;
use Xchat qw( :all );
register('CRC Check Script', '1.0', 'Check CRC');
hook_print('DCC RECV Complete', \&check_crc);
sub check_crc {
my $filename = $_[0][0];
my $filepath = $_[0][1];
if ($_[0][0] =~ /([a-fA-F0-9]{8})/){
open($somefile, '<', $filepath);
binmode $somefile;
my $crc = crc32(*$somefile);
close($somefile);
my $hexval = uc(sprintf("%x", $crc));
if ($filename =~ $hexval) {
delaycommand("CRC is \00303OK!");
} else {
delaycommand("CRC is \00306NOT OK! - " .$hexval);
}
return EAT_NONE;
}
};
#I don't understand why we're using a timer instead of just standard print, but sure
sub delaycommand {
my $command = $_[0];
hook_timer( 0,
sub {
prnt($command);
return REMOVE;
}
);
return EAT_NONE;
}
